Manchester United star Antony has explained his celebration against Arsenal after an Old Trafford debut which gave him “goosebumps”.

The forward, signed for £83m from Ajax on deadline day, opened the scoring in the 3-1 win over Arsenal on Sunday on his debut for the Red Devils.

His move to the club was a long time coming having made it clear to Ajax that he wanted to follow Erik ten Hag to United early in the transfer window.

With the Dutch side eager to retain him, the 22-year-old went on strike to force a move and eventually got his move.

And got off to quite the start, slotting the ball past Aaron Ramsdale before thumping the club crest with his fist, then clawing at and kissing it in a passionate display to the fans.

Not done yet, Antony turned to a camera and gestured at it with tiger claws, which he later explained to the official Manchester United website.

He explained: “It’s a friends thing. So when I score a goal, my friends know what it is, it’s a tiger. They know and that’s how I celebrate.”

Antony also revealed the feeling of scoring his first goal at Old Trafford.

He added: “To score my first goal and share this moment with the crowd, with a great atmosphere, was brilliant.

“From the moment I stepped on to the pitch, I already had goosebumps because I know how much I wanted to be here and I know how much the crowd wanted this.

“When I saw the ball going in, and the net shaking, I express all my feelings the way I did. Yes, it gave me goosebumps for sure.”

Teammate Diogo Dalot hailed the winger’s performance and believes the fans will enjoy the character he’s already illustrated.

“(Playing with Antony was) very good,” the Portugal right-back said. “He showed that in just two or three days that he could come on and make the difference he made with a beautiful goal, beautiful team goal.

“He is one more player to help, we want to build a very good squad this season and with him we are going have more quality.

“He has the advantage of knowing the way that the manager thinks.

“He’s already adapted to his football side and now he’s adapted to his new team-mates and I think you could see in the minutes that he played that he showed some character, he showed some desire, which I’m sure every fan will love.

“The quality that he has, the mentality that he has, I think he will improve us.”
